I used to have hair down to my waist when I was younger and had a ton of barrettes and hair ties. I started listing them and was shocked at how much they were selling for. Most of them sell for between $15-$20 but a few have gone for $25-$30. Some of my Stay tights have gone for $50 and they weren't even marked. Now I keep an eye out for lots cause although they are slow sellers they do eventually sell and are easy to list and ship. And you are right that the FRANCE ones do seem to sell higher but they all sell even some that I bought at the Dollar Tree.
